Culvert replacement services involve removing and installing new culverts to ensure proper water flow beneath roads, driveways, or pathways. The process typically includes assessing the existing culvert's condition, excavating the area, and installing a suitable replacement that meets the property's drainage needs. These services are essential for maintaining the structural integrity of infrastructure and preventing water-related issues that can lead to erosion, flooding, or damage to property foundations.
Replacing a culvert helps address common problems such as blockages, deterioration, or failure of existing culverts, which can cause water to back up or flow improperly. Over time, culverts may become clogged with debris, corroded, or cracked, leading to potential flooding or water pooling around critical areas. Timely replacement can mitigate these risks, improve drainage efficiency, and protect the landscape and structures from water-related damage.

Cost Range for Culvert Replacement - Typical costs for culvert replacement services can vary widely depending on the project's scope and location. In Glen Allen, VA, replacement expenses often range from $3,000 to $8,000 for standard installations. Larger or more complex projects may cost significantly more.
Factors Influencing Costs - The total cost depends on factors such as culvert size, material, and site accessibility. For example, a small concrete culvert might cost around $3,500, while a larger steel culvert could reach $10,000 or more.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project needs.
Average Project Expenses - On average, culvert replacement projects in the area tend to fall between $4,000 and $9,000. These figures include labor, materials, and site preparation, but costs can vary depending on project complexity and location-specific conditions.
Cost Considerations - Costs may increase if additional work such as drainage improvements or roadway repairs is required. Pros can assess site conditions to provide accurate estimates tailored to individual project requ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
